Parents and teachers should prioritize vocabulary expansion activities like "Extra Challenge Missing Vowels" for 4-year-olds because early language development lays the foundation for overall learning and communication skills. This game encourages children to identify and produce words, enhancing their phonemic awareness and spelling abilities. By engaging them in fun, challenging activities, children become more motivated to explore language, developing a love for reading and learning.
At this stage, vocabulary growth is linked to cognitive development, as children begin to form thoughts and ideas. A robust vocabulary allows them to articulate feelings and understand others better, promoting crucial social skills.
Moreover, a strong vocabulary is correlated with academic success in later years. Children with diverse word knowledge tend to excel in subjects such as reading and writing, impacting their future educational achievements.
Incorporating activities like "Missing Vowels" not only challenges children cognitively but also makes learning enjoyable. It fosters an interactive environment where children collaborate with peers or caregivers, nurturing communication and teamwork skills.
Ultimately, supporting vocabulary expansion helps young learners develop the linguistic tools they need to express themselves confidently and effectively in a variety of contexts, enriching their personal and academic journeys.
